How do you know how many of a certain color / model were sold in the US? I'm looking to upgrade my silver 2010 Panamera Turbo and would like to get a sense of how many Carmine Red 2017s were sold before going to my backup of the Saphire Blue..
PCNAL and PORS9 seem to be the best sources for production data. I also use Total 911 to kind of double check. There are also some guys on RL that have done some checking from VIN numbers. It is not easy, just have to hunt for the data and try to piece it together. That said, the newer the car, the more difficult it is to find numbers. Seems to be about a 2 year lag. Seems to me the 2016 numbers are finally starting to settle down. 2017 will be tough. I have seen numbers on special cars like the GT2RS colors on FB in the group forums.
